Real Estate Agents Website - Property Listings & Admin CMS
This Real Estate Agents Website is a deploy-ready property marketing and management platform for estate agents, realtors, property agencies, landlords, and real estate companies. The public website includes a premium homepage, property listing pages, property details with galleries, sale and rental filters, furnished and commercial listing pages, neighbourhood guides, blog posts, testimonials, FAQ, contact forms, property valuation requests, property request forms, favourites, comparison, account pages, WhatsApp support, and live chat. The admin side includes property management, property editor, image upload, amenities management, neighbourhood management, viewing schedules, leads, property requests, blog management, testimonials, FAQ, lookup data, content sections, admin/super-admin dashboards, and role-protected routes. The code uses a React + TypeScript + Vite frontend with Supabase integration, Supabase migrations/storage policies, and a MySQL schema file included as a reference/alternative database structure.

Requirements & installation +
Requirements
- Node.js 18 or newer
- npm or bun
- A Supabase project for database
- auth
- storage
Installation
- 1 Upload or clone the project files
- 2 Copy .env.example to .env
- 3 Create a Supabase project
- 4 Set VITE_SUPABASE_PROJECT_ID
- 5 VITE_SUPABASE_URL
- 6 and VITE_SUPABASE_PUBLISHABLE_KEY
- 7 Apply the Supabase migrations from the supabase/migrations folder
- 8 Create/configure the admin-uploads storage bucket if it is not created by migration
- 9 Run npm install
- 10 Run npm run build
- 11 Upload the dist folder to static hosting or deploy the project to Vercel/Netlify
- 12 Configure SPA fallback routing so direct URLs such as /properties and /property/:id work
